Ibadan is quite modern. The people are very friendly, respectful, and almost every Nigerian tribe is ably represented in the city. We arrived at Murtala Muhammed Airport Lagos after our flight with Emirates. You can mostly count on air conditioning, a nice bed, warm water , electricity and good WiFi in most of the hotels and houses, I stayed at Kakanfo Inn for a night, when I arrived at Ibadan and the service was exceptional. I did some shopping and watched a Nollywood movie in the cinema in Cocoa House (the first skyscraper in Africa). I also loved the Zoological Garden in the University of Ibadan (the first University in Nigeria). So I took many pictures..
